当前位置 主页 > 技术大全 >

    高效指南:如何备份原数据库
    怎么备份原数据库

    栏目:技术大全 时间:2025-04-02 02:24



    如何高效且安全地备份原数据库:一份详尽指南 在当今信息化高度发达的时代,数据已成为企业最宝贵的资产之一

        无论是金融、医疗、教育还是电子商务等行业,数据的完整性和安全性直接关系到业务的连续性和客户的信任

        因此,定期备份原数据库不仅是数据管理的基本要求,更是企业风险防控的关键策略

        本文将深入探讨如何高效且安全地备份原数据库,从备份的重要性、备份类型、实施步骤、最佳实践到自动化与监控,为您提供一份全面的操作指南

         一、备份的重要性:为何不容忽视 1.数据恢复的基础:面对自然灾害、硬件故障、人为错误或恶意攻击等不可预见事件,备份是恢复业务运行、减少数据丢失的唯一途径

         2.合规性要求:许多行业和地区都有严格的数据保护和隐私法规,如GDPR(欧盟通用数据保护条例)、HIPAA(美国健康保险流通与责任法案)等,定期备份是满足这些合规要求的基础

         3.业务连续性保障:在数据成为业务核心驱动力的今天,任何数据中断都可能导致重大经济损失

        有效的备份策略能确保业务在最短时间内恢复正常运营

         4.测试与开发环境支持:备份数据还可以用于非生产环境的测试和开发,促进产品迭代升级,而不影响生产数据的完整性和安全性

         二、备份类型:选择适合的策略 1.全量备份:复制数据库中的所有数据

        虽然耗时较长,但恢复时最为完整和快速

         2.增量备份:仅备份自上次备份以来发生变化的数据

        节省存储空间,但恢复时需结合全量备份进行

         3.差异备份:备份自上次全量备份以来发生变化的所有数据

        恢复时比增量备份稍快,但仍需全量备份作为基础

         4.日志备份:针对支持事务日志的数据库系统(如SQL Server、Oracle),记录所有事务操作,适用于需要最小恢复点目标(RPO)的场景

         三、备份实施步骤:从规划到执行 1.评估需求:明确备份的频率(如每日、每周)、保留周期(如30天、90天)、数据类型(全量、增量/差异)及恢复时间目标(RTO)和恢复点目标(RPO)

         2.选择合适的工具:根据数据库类型(如MySQL、PostgreSQL、Oracle、SQL Server等),选择官方工具或第三方备份软件

        考虑工具的兼容性、性能、易用性及成本

         3.制定备份计划:结合业务需求,规划备份窗口(尽量避开业务高峰期),设定自动化任务

         4.执行首次全量备份:确保所有数据都被完整捕获,为后续增量/差异备份奠定基础

         5.实施增量/差异备份:根据计划定期执行,同时监控备份任务的执行状态和日志

         6.验证备份有效性:定期进行备份恢复测试,确保备份数据可用,且恢复过程符合预期

         四、最佳实践:提升备份效率与安全性 1.加密备份数据:无论是存储还是传输过程中,都应采用强加密算法保护备份数据,防止数据泄露

         2.异地备份:将备份数据存放在与主数据中心物理隔离的位置,以抵御区域性灾难

         3.版本控制:对备份文件实施版本控制,便于追踪和管理,同时避免误用旧版本数据

         4.压缩与去重:利用压缩技术减少存储空间占用,通过去重技术消除重复数据,提高效率

         5.网络优化:对于远程备份,优化网络带宽使用,考虑使用增量传输或差分传输技术减少数据传输量

         6.文档化流程:详细记录备份策略、操作步骤、应急恢复流程等,确保团队成员都能理解和执行

         五、自动化与监控:迈向智能备份管理 1.自动化备份任务:利用脚本或备份软件内置的调度功能,实现备份任务的自动化执行,减少人为错误

         2.智能监控与告警:部署监控系统,实时监控备份任务的执行状态、存储使用情况、数据完整性等关键指标,一旦异常立即触发告警

         3.容量规划与预测:基于历史备份数据增长趋势,进行容量规划,提前准备存储空间,避免备份失败

         4.备份策略动态调整:根据业务增长、数据变化及新技术应用情况,定期评估并调整备份策略,确保始终高效且安全

         六、结语:备份,永不止步 数据库备份是一项持续性的工作,它不仅仅是技术的实施,更是企业文化的体现

        随着技术的不断进步和业务需求的日益复杂,备份策略也需要不断进化

        企业应建立跨部门协作机制,将数据库备份纳入整体数据治理框架,持续提升备份效率、安全性和灵活性

        记住,一次成功的备份可能默默无闻,但一次失败的备份足以让一切努力付诸东流

        因此,对待数据库备份,我们永远不能掉以轻心,必须持之以恒,精益求精

         总之,高效且安全的数据库备份是现代企业数据管理的基石,它不仅关乎数据的存亡,更直接关系到企业的竞争力和生存能力

        通过上述指南的实践,企业可以构建起一套适合自己的备份体系,为数据的长期安全保驾护航